Ocena wątku:
  • 0 głosów - średnia: 0
  • 1
  • 2
  • 3
  • 4
  • 5
htaccess zmienna nie działa
#1
jak ustawić zmienną w przekierowaniu z flagami [R,L,E=ZMIENNA:ok]

chodzi o to że jeżeli dokonam przekierowania chce ustawić jakąś zmienną
kiedy używam
Kod:
SetEnv ZMIENNA ok
wszystko działa jak należy mogę pobrać sobie zmienną w pliku php
poleceniem $_SERVER['REDIRECT_ZMIENNA'];

kiedy przekierowuje bez L to również wszystko działa

problem jest wtedy gdy chce ustawić zmienną podczas przekierowania L+R
Kod:
RewriteRule ^jakasstrona/$ /jakasstrona.php [R,L,E=ZMIENNA:ok]

Flagi [R,L] potrzebne do zmiany adresu w przeglądarce
Flaga [E] ma niby ustawiać zmienną środowiskową w apache ale nie robi nic
jak ustawić zmienną środowiskową którą mogę odczytać w pliku php po zmianie adresu w przeglądarce??
Odpowiedz
#2
jednak nie ma takiej możliwości
apache nie ustawi zmiennej po przekierowaniu mimo że jest podana jako flaga/parametr
sposób działania htaccessa nie daje takiej możliwości
Odpowiedz


Podobne wątki…
Wątek: Autor Odpowiedzi: Wyświetleń: Ostatni post
  [PHP] Nieprawidłowo działa wyświetlanie i stronicowanie zdjęć martinprz 0 1,808 26-01-2013, 20:14
Ostatni post: martinprz
  Nie działa STRONA po zmianie haseł FTP [email protected] 8 6,333 12-12-2012, 02:21
Ostatni post: andrzejhi
  [PHP][MYSQL] Nie działa skrypt wyszukiwarki martinprz 1 2,476 19-11-2012, 18:26
Ostatni post: Engine
  [PHP+shadowbox] Nie działa galeria martinprz 0 1,796 16-11-2012, 03:59
Ostatni post: martinprz
  [PHP]pole opcji(radio) działa jak pole wyboru(checkbox) eremen 2 2,775 19-02-2012, 23:36
Ostatni post: eremen

Skocz do:


Użytkownicy przeglądający ten wątek: 2 gości
Sponsorzy i przyjaciele
SeoHost.pl